Sudarsan Pattnaik Bags Fred Darrington Award at UK Festival

Lord Ganesha Sand Sculpture Wins Global Accolades

Sudarsan Pattnaik, a renowned sand artist from Odisha, India, has been honored with the “Fred Darrington 1st British Sand Master Award” at the Sandworld Sand Sculpture Festival in Weymouth, UK.


Pattnaik’s magnificent 10-foot-tall sand sculpture of Lord Ganesha, accompanied by the message “World Peace,” captivated audiences and earned him this prestigious recognition. This marks the first time an Indian artist has received this award, highlighting Pattnaik’s unparalleled contributions to the field of sand art.

The award ceremony, attended by prominent personalities including representatives from the Indian High Commission in London, was a celebration of Fred Darrington’s centenary, a key figure in sand art’s legacy. Jon Orell, the Mayor of Weymouth, presented the award to Pattnaik, recognizing his artistic excellence and commitment to promoting cultural heritage on a global platform.

Odisha’s Chief Minister, Mohan Majhi, lauded Pattnaik’s achievement, stating that his work has elevated India’s cultural presence internationally. With over 65 international sand sculpture championships under his belt, Pattnaik continues to inspire artists and enthusiasts worldwide.
